Health workers threatened if outbreak information
leaks
MORON, Cuba - September 26 (Abel Escobar
Ramírez / www.cubanet.org) - Workers
at the Morón General Hospital in
Ciego de Ávila province say they
have been warned that should any of them
leak any information about the current outbreak
of dengue fever they will lose their jobs
without any right to appeal.
One worker who asked not to be named said
the different departments in the facility
have been informed that should any information
leak out to radio stations or web pages
abroad, the informants will be fired because
this information, according to hospital
administrators, "is used by the enemy
to overthrow the Revolution."
The worker said that in general workers
are fearful to express any concerns they
may have lest they be taken as informants
and fired. So, he said, a recent breakdown
of the water pumps feeding the hospital
went unreported for days.
